mirror of
https://github.com/dscalzi/HeliosLauncher.git
synced 2024-12-22 19:52:14 -08:00
v0.0.1-alpha.16 - Fixed download errors.
Fixed error 'self signed certificate in certificate chain'. Disabled reject unauthorized in assetexec process. Fixed error messages from assetexec to renderer. Updated elctron-builder to v20.25.0.
This commit is contained in:
parent
5bceaa92d0
commit
6e71cd6b46
@ -1,5 +1,7 @@
|
|||||||
const { AssetGuard } = require('./assetguard')
|
const { AssetGuard } = require('./assetguard')
|
||||||
|
|
||||||
|
process.env.NODE_TLS_REJECT_UNAUTHORIZED = '0'
|
||||||
|
|
||||||
const tracker = new AssetGuard(process.argv[2], process.argv[3])
|
const tracker = new AssetGuard(process.argv[2], process.argv[3])
|
||||||
console.log('AssetExec Started')
|
console.log('AssetExec Started')
|
||||||
|
|
||||||
@ -31,7 +33,7 @@ process.on('message', (msg) => {
|
|||||||
res.then((v) => {
|
res.then((v) => {
|
||||||
process.send({result: v, context: func})
|
process.send({result: v, context: func})
|
||||||
}).catch((err) => {
|
}).catch((err) => {
|
||||||
process.send({result: err, context: func})
|
process.send({result: err.message, context: func})
|
||||||
})
|
})
|
||||||
} else {
|
} else {
|
||||||
process.send({result: res, context: func})
|
process.send({result: res, context: func})
|
||||||
|
@ -569,6 +569,11 @@ function dlAsync(login = true){
|
|||||||
}
|
}
|
||||||
} else if(m.context === 'validateEverything'){
|
} else if(m.context === 'validateEverything'){
|
||||||
|
|
||||||
|
// If these properties are not defined it's likely an error.
|
||||||
|
if(m.result.forgeData == null || m.result.versionData == null){
|
||||||
|
console.error(m.result)
|
||||||
|
}
|
||||||
|
|
||||||
forgeData = m.result.forgeData
|
forgeData = m.result.forgeData
|
||||||
versionData = m.result.versionData
|
versionData = m.result.versionData
|
||||||
|
|
||||||
|
48
package-lock.json
generated
48
package-lock.json
generated
@ -1,6 +1,6 @@
|
|||||||
{
|
{
|
||||||
"name": "westeroscraftlauncher",
|
"name": "westeroscraftlauncher",
|
||||||
"version": "0.0.1-alpha.15",
|
"version": "0.0.1-alpha.16",
|
||||||
"lockfileVersion": 1,
|
"lockfileVersion": 1,
|
||||||
"requires": true,
|
"requires": true,
|
||||||
"dependencies": {
|
"dependencies": {
|
||||||
@ -123,22 +123,22 @@
|
|||||||
"dev": true
|
"dev": true
|
||||||
},
|
},
|
||||||
"app-builder-lib": {
|
"app-builder-lib": {
|
||||||
"version": "20.24.5",
|
"version": "20.25.0",
|
||||||
"resolved": "https://registry.npmjs.org/app-builder-lib/-/app-builder-lib-20.24.5.tgz",
|
"resolved": "https://registry.npmjs.org/app-builder-lib/-/app-builder-lib-20.25.0.tgz",
|
||||||
"integrity": "sha512-nk9VCpJ8/OFQGsbCUlY5h4SLU85fh2eVEdIwm4e+TwrcnXNOoAsSPe6H6dLio+SybhW+C7GNk+aYIg2l+JVRXA==",
|
"integrity": "sha512-jOvX5myrzYy5vPAgI8/hRYer0ee06DRUmGFXFKTLyNvmi96d02DgEFERFc1BLHOCmGe1RxsDVTuiz+qoSqcjkQ==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"requires": {
|
"requires": {
|
||||||
"7zip-bin": "~4.0.2",
|
"7zip-bin": "~4.0.2",
|
||||||
"app-builder-bin": "1.11.4",
|
"app-builder-bin": "1.11.4",
|
||||||
"async-exit-hook": "^2.0.1",
|
"async-exit-hook": "^2.0.1",
|
||||||
"bluebird-lst": "^1.0.5",
|
"bluebird-lst": "^1.0.5",
|
||||||
"builder-util": "5.18.1",
|
"builder-util": "5.19.0",
|
||||||
"builder-util-runtime": "4.4.1",
|
"builder-util-runtime": "4.4.1",
|
||||||
"chromium-pickle-js": "^0.2.0",
|
"chromium-pickle-js": "^0.2.0",
|
||||||
"debug": "^3.1.0",
|
"debug": "^3.1.0",
|
||||||
"ejs": "^2.6.1",
|
"ejs": "^2.6.1",
|
||||||
"electron-osx-sign": "0.4.10",
|
"electron-osx-sign": "0.4.10",
|
||||||
"electron-publish": "20.24.2",
|
"electron-publish": "20.25.0",
|
||||||
"env-paths": "^1.0.0",
|
"env-paths": "^1.0.0",
|
||||||
"fs-extra-p": "^4.6.1",
|
"fs-extra-p": "^4.6.1",
|
||||||
"hosted-git-info": "^2.7.1",
|
"hosted-git-info": "^2.7.1",
|
||||||
@ -463,9 +463,9 @@
|
|||||||
"integrity": "sha512-c5mRlguI/Pe2dSZmpER62rSCu0ryKmWddzRYsuXc50U2/g8jMOulc31VZMa4mYx31U5xsmSOpDCgH88Vl9cDGQ=="
|
"integrity": "sha512-c5mRlguI/Pe2dSZmpER62rSCu0ryKmWddzRYsuXc50U2/g8jMOulc31VZMa4mYx31U5xsmSOpDCgH88Vl9cDGQ=="
|
||||||
},
|
},
|
||||||
"builder-util": {
|
"builder-util": {
|
||||||
"version": "5.18.1",
|
"version": "5.19.0",
|
||||||
"resolved": "https://registry.npmjs.org/builder-util/-/builder-util-5.18.1.tgz",
|
"resolved": "https://registry.npmjs.org/builder-util/-/builder-util-5.19.0.tgz",
|
||||||
"integrity": "sha512-wfffo0HyDY2FReYU9Uc5Rj9HqK3wANeBaj8LIgjmg/yugIZ3UwqOtJzO24svfPrzyt7Ycw1QAKg0Z8cCHUUmbA==",
|
"integrity": "sha512-MKkixmVsPLHFrG8EOqfKz1VOUfyxVkrSr/A4o9fJZz4+dyf0CJTjCoa97OzRc7YYfPCbUs/Q0GQwal0Kinw9uA==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"requires": {
|
"requires": {
|
||||||
"7zip-bin": "~4.0.2",
|
"7zip-bin": "~4.0.2",
|
||||||
@ -897,14 +897,14 @@
|
|||||||
}
|
}
|
||||||
},
|
},
|
||||||
"dmg-builder": {
|
"dmg-builder": {
|
||||||
"version": "5.0.3",
|
"version": "5.0.4",
|
||||||
"resolved": "https://registry.npmjs.org/dmg-builder/-/dmg-builder-5.0.3.tgz",
|
"resolved": "https://registry.npmjs.org/dmg-builder/-/dmg-builder-5.0.4.tgz",
|
||||||
"integrity": "sha512-P0oEYXqQYeE7J3TueVrpQxs4v1NNLGzIIljHG4fXGIiq5uDnNqDubglxMh9zC6MhO2tXxRU5dr/8U2WcDqXN0w==",
|
"integrity": "sha512-EAMCcpAwo/hpyhEaRzoWwTzUgrqS1AOU2GkbhyfgeVKwWU9kkuRfPz1NJFzWGKFcBkTO9zbi2DMEotqOzNg1aw==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"requires": {
|
"requires": {
|
||||||
"app-builder-lib": "~20.24.5",
|
"app-builder-lib": "~20.25.0",
|
||||||
"bluebird-lst": "^1.0.5",
|
"bluebird-lst": "^1.0.5",
|
||||||
"builder-util": "~5.18.1",
|
"builder-util": "~5.19.0",
|
||||||
"fs-extra-p": "^4.6.1",
|
"fs-extra-p": "^4.6.1",
|
||||||
"iconv-lite": "^0.4.23",
|
"iconv-lite": "^0.4.23",
|
||||||
"js-yaml": "^3.12.0",
|
"js-yaml": "^3.12.0",
|
||||||
@ -983,17 +983,17 @@
|
|||||||
}
|
}
|
||||||
},
|
},
|
||||||
"electron-builder": {
|
"electron-builder": {
|
||||||
"version": "20.24.5",
|
"version": "20.25.0",
|
||||||
"resolved": "https://registry.npmjs.org/electron-builder/-/electron-builder-20.24.5.tgz",
|
"resolved": "https://registry.npmjs.org/electron-builder/-/electron-builder-20.25.0.tgz",
|
||||||
"integrity": "sha512-NMwQQlWtG3IZTZI2XdPGGUloxV1yewQQlbUUhUw6BimRS2cYkBpgVBUTlehs/mHCx5MUX+kt7HC01OihySPM/g==",
|
"integrity": "sha512-Fk30YHabm+EEJ9C9WlDwTJUMqci7tF1FMUvvDu4/bSVCfMCF6pqjfE3ymHFCmFDaTdqpHa5yHRmMOu5ey+YyLA==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"requires": {
|
"requires": {
|
||||||
"app-builder-lib": "20.24.5",
|
"app-builder-lib": "20.25.0",
|
||||||
"bluebird-lst": "^1.0.5",
|
"bluebird-lst": "^1.0.5",
|
||||||
"builder-util": "5.18.1",
|
"builder-util": "5.19.0",
|
||||||
"builder-util-runtime": "4.4.1",
|
"builder-util-runtime": "4.4.1",
|
||||||
"chalk": "^2.4.1",
|
"chalk": "^2.4.1",
|
||||||
"dmg-builder": "5.0.3",
|
"dmg-builder": "5.0.4",
|
||||||
"fs-extra-p": "^4.6.1",
|
"fs-extra-p": "^4.6.1",
|
||||||
"is-ci": "^1.1.0",
|
"is-ci": "^1.1.0",
|
||||||
"lazy-val": "^1.0.3",
|
"lazy-val": "^1.0.3",
|
||||||
@ -1053,13 +1053,13 @@
|
|||||||
}
|
}
|
||||||
},
|
},
|
||||||
"electron-publish": {
|
"electron-publish": {
|
||||||
"version": "20.24.2",
|
"version": "20.25.0",
|
||||||
"resolved": "https://registry.npmjs.org/electron-publish/-/electron-publish-20.24.2.tgz",
|
"resolved": "https://registry.npmjs.org/electron-publish/-/electron-publish-20.25.0.tgz",
|
||||||
"integrity": "sha512-ngGDjN7NEmUS2Zd6vrqLdfTRCH/ROFFUPbK0Ph79zOqR1oiveM8sZVRE99IdOLZEeXHZjvssGmZb4WsYxr/wyg==",
|
"integrity": "sha512-XU1Bc6gwmupzufFrOOePmBsp1sbvzAAP/q1VkvfRunl950M/dqY7ENm6E8zpALgKgYL5guaBFMbR9/rc5Qibew==",
|
||||||
"dev": true,
|
"dev": true,
|
||||||
"requires": {
|
"requires": {
|
||||||
"bluebird-lst": "^1.0.5",
|
"bluebird-lst": "^1.0.5",
|
||||||
"builder-util": "~5.18.0",
|
"builder-util": "~5.19.0",
|
||||||
"builder-util-runtime": "^4.4.1",
|
"builder-util-runtime": "^4.4.1",
|
||||||
"chalk": "^2.4.1",
|
"chalk": "^2.4.1",
|
||||||
"fs-extra-p": "^4.6.1",
|
"fs-extra-p": "^4.6.1",
|
||||||
|
@ -1,6 +1,6 @@
|
|||||||
{
|
{
|
||||||
"name": "westeroscraftlauncher",
|
"name": "westeroscraftlauncher",
|
||||||
"version": "0.0.1-alpha.15",
|
"version": "0.0.1-alpha.16",
|
||||||
"description": "Custom modded launcher for Westeroscraft",
|
"description": "Custom modded launcher for Westeroscraft",
|
||||||
"productName": "WesterosCraft Launcher",
|
"productName": "WesterosCraft Launcher",
|
||||||
"main": "index.js",
|
"main": "index.js",
|
||||||
@ -48,7 +48,7 @@
|
|||||||
},
|
},
|
||||||
"devDependencies": {
|
"devDependencies": {
|
||||||
"electron": "^2.0.5",
|
"electron": "^2.0.5",
|
||||||
"electron-builder": "^20.24.5",
|
"electron-builder": "^20.25.0",
|
||||||
"eslint": "^5.2.0"
|
"eslint": "^5.2.0"
|
||||||
},
|
},
|
||||||
"build": {
|
"build": {
|
||||||
|
Loading…
Reference in New Issue
Block a user